Introduction:
The market for laxative and constipation relief products in Brazil has been steadily growing in recent years, reflecting a global trend of increasing demand for digestive health solutions. According to market research, the Brazilian market for these products has seen a 10% annual growth rate, with an estimated market size of $500 million. As consumers become more health-conscious, the demand for effective and reliable laxatives and constipation relief products continues to rise.

Insights:
The market for laxative and constipation relief products in Brazil is expected to continue growing in the coming years, driven by increasing awareness of digestive health issues among consumers. With a projected annual growth rate of 8%, the market is set to reach $700 million by 2025. Manufacturers are focusing on developing more natural and gentle formulations to meet the evolving needs of the Brazilian market. Additionally, e-commerce sales of laxative products are on the rise, offering convenience and accessibility to consumers seeking relief from constipation.
